Synopsis An account of a slave rebellion aboard the Spanish ship Amistad in 1839. En route from Africa to the West Indies, the slaves aboard ship mutinied and killed most of the the crew, but were then deceived by the captain, who steered the ship to the American shore rather than back to Africa as he had been ordered by his captors. In the U.S., the slaves were imprisoned and became the subjects of one of the most elaborate and celebrated Supreme Court cases of the day, in which former U.S. president John Quincy Adams argued that they were, by rights, free men who could not be held captive or detained against their will.
